Quick Answer: Google Ads works for a bakery when the search has a date and a budget behind it — custom cakes, corporate dessert boxes, festive pre-orders. It works badly for “bakery near me”, which Maps already wins for free.
Split campaigns by order value, not by product. A RM 45 cake and a RM 3,000 wedding order should never share a budget, because the algorithm will happily spend everything on the cheap one and report a lovely cost per lead.

Quick Answer: Corporate and school orders die in procurement, not in the kitchen. A single page carrying your halal status, premises registration, allergen policy and invoicing terms is what lets an admin tick the box and place the order.
Malaysian bakeries sit under two separate regimes, and buyers check both. Halal certification is issued by JAKIM and applied for through the MYeHALAL system — and anyone can verify a bakery’s halal status on the official Halal Malaysia portal under the “Premis Makanan” category. Separately, food premises must be registered and food handlers trained and vaccinated under Malaysia’s food hygiene rules, enforced by the Ministry of Health Malaysia.

Quick Answer: An everyday counter order costs RM 5 to RM 12 in media. A wholesale supply account costs RM 780 to RM 1,540. Both can be profitable, and running them from one budget guarantees the algorithm spends almost everything on the cheap one.
| Order type | Cost per enquiry (RM) | Enquiry to order | Cost per order (RM)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Everyday bread & buns | 3 – 6 | 52% | 5 – 12 |
| Custom birthday cake | 9 – 19 | 36% | 25 – 53 |
| Festive cookies & kek lapis | 6 – 13 | 43% | 14 – 30 |
| Hampers & gifting boxes | 12 – 24 | 28% | 43 – 86 |
| Corporate dessert boxes | 27 – 53 | 21% | 129 – 252 |
| Wedding cake | 44 – 86 | 13% | 338 – 662 |
| Cafe & hotel wholesale supply | 70 – 139 | 9% | 780 – 1,540 |
Source: ZenWeb-managed campaigns, Malaysian bakery accounts, 2024–2026.
Read the middle column, not the last one. Counter orders convert at 52% because the decision is small and immediate; wholesale converts at 9% because it is a supplier decision made over weeks. A single campaign covering both hands nearly all the budget to bread — profitable, but it caps your average order value permanently. Splitting them is a five-minute change in Google Ads.
Quick Answer: Maps supplies 58% of everyday counter orders and 6% of wedding cakes. Instagram and TikTok supply 47% of weddings and 11% of bread. Wholesale is 31% repeat and referral. The channel that feeds you depends entirely on what you are trying to sell.
| Order type | Google Search | Google Maps | Instagram & TikTok | WhatsApp repeat & referral |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Everyday bread & buns | 9 | 58 | 11 | 22 |
| Custom birthday cake | 34 | 18 | 33 | 15 |
| Festive cookies & kek lapis | 21 | 9 | 38 | 32 |
| Wedding cake | 29 | 6 | 47 | 18 |
| Corporate dessert boxes | 47 | 13 | 12 | 28 |
| Cafe & hotel wholesale supply | 52 | 8 | 9 | 31 |
Source: ZenWeb client tracking, Malaysian bakery accounts, 2024–2026.
Two rows are worth arguing about. Festive cookies come 32% from WhatsApp repeat and referral, which means your customer list is a bigger festive asset than your ad budget — see WhatsApp marketing in Malaysia. And wholesale comes 52% from search, which is why bakeries chasing cafe accounts on Instagram usually wait a long time.

Quick Answer: Bakery demand runs to the festive calendar, not the retail one. Enquiries peak around the Raya cookie season and again in December, then fall by half in the month after Raya. Booking lead time stretches from four days in a quiet month to sixteen in the peak.
| Month | Enquiry index | Index (avg = 100) | Median days booked ahead |
|---|---|---|---|
| January | 86 | 4 | |
| February | 128 | 11 | |
| March | 152 | 16 | |
| April | 78 | 3 | |
| May | 82 | 4 | |
| June | 87 | 5 | |
| July | 80 | 4 | |
| August | 84 | 4 | |
| September | 109 | 9 | |
| October | 93 | 5 | |
| November | 98 | 6 | |
| December | 123 | 12 |
Source: ZenWeb client tracking, Malaysian bakery accounts, 2024–2026. Raya months shift yearly.

Most bakeries start between RM 1,200 and RM 4,000 a month across search, Maps and social, plus the website build. Budgets should flex with the calendar, rising well before the Raya cookie season and December. Keep media cost per order under roughly 10% of your average order value.
Yes, at least a starting-from band per size. Hidden prices filter out serious buyers rather than tyre-kickers, because someone with a date in mind simply moves to the bakery that showed a number. Published bands also cut the hours you lose quoting orders you were never going to win.
Certification is voluntary, but it is decisive for many corporate, school and event buyers, and it is checked. Applications go through JAKIM’s MYeHALAL system, and buyers can verify your status on the Halal Malaysia portal. If you are not certified, state your position plainly rather than staying silent.
They do different jobs. Google catches people who already need a cake on a specific date, which suits birthdays, corporate boxes and wholesale. Instagram creates demand for weddings, new products and festive pre-orders. If you only have budget for one, start where your current orders come from.
Google Ads and a tidy Google Business Profile can produce orders within the first two to four weeks. Cake type and area pages generally start ranking between month four and month eight. Corporate and wholesale accounts usually land around month four to seven, once your halal and invoicing pages exist for procurement to read.
